如何进行PDM产品生产系统的二次开发?
随着我国制造业的快速发展,PDM(Product Data Management,产品数据管理)系统在产品研发、生产、销售等领域得到了广泛应用。PDM系统作为一种高效的产品信息管理工具,可以帮助企业实现产品数据的集中管理、协同开发、过程控制和版本管理等功能。然而,在实际应用过程中,企业往往需要根据自身业务需求对PDM系统进行二次开发,以满足个性化需求。本文将详细介绍如何进行PDM产品生产系统的二次开发。
一、了解PDM系统及其二次开发
- PDM系统简介
PDM系统是一种面向产品全生命周期的信息化管理系统,主要包括以下功能:
(1)产品数据管理:实现产品数据的集中存储、分类、检索、共享等功能。
(2)协同开发:支持团队成员之间的信息共享、协同设计、协同审核等功能。
(3)过程控制:对产品研发、生产、销售等过程进行监控、跟踪、审计等功能。
(4)版本管理:实现产品数据的版本控制,确保产品数据的准确性和一致性。
- PDM系统二次开发
PDM系统二次开发是指根据企业实际需求,对PDM系统进行功能扩展、性能优化、系统集成等操作。二次开发主要分为以下几种类型:
(1)功能扩展:在原有功能基础上,增加新的功能模块,满足企业个性化需求。
(2)性能优化:针对PDM系统的运行效率、稳定性等方面进行优化,提高系统性能。
(3)系统集成:将PDM系统与其他信息系统(如ERP、CRM等)进行集成,实现数据共享和业务协同。
二、PDM产品生产系统二次开发步骤
- 需求分析
在二次开发前,首先要对企业的业务需求进行深入分析,明确以下内容:
(1)企业现有的PDM系统版本及功能模块。
(2)企业业务流程及数据流程。
(3)企业对PDM系统的需求,包括功能需求、性能需求、安全性需求等。
- 系统设计
根据需求分析结果,设计PDM产品生产系统的二次开发方案,主要包括以下内容:
(1)功能设计:明确新增功能模块、优化功能模块、集成功能模块等。
(2)性能设计:针对系统性能进行优化,如数据库优化、缓存优化等。
(3)安全性设计:确保系统安全,如用户权限管理、数据加密等。
- 开发与测试
根据系统设计方案,进行PDM产品生产系统的二次开发。开发过程中,需注意以下事项:
(1)遵循软件工程规范,确保代码质量。
(2)进行单元测试、集成测试、系统测试等,确保系统稳定运行。
- 部署与实施
完成开发与测试后,将PDM产品生产系统部署到生产环境中。部署过程中,需注意以下事项:
(1)数据迁移:将原有数据迁移到新系统。
(2)用户培训:对用户进行系统操作培训。
(3)系统运维:建立系统运维团队,确保系统稳定运行。
- 持续优化
在PDM产品生产系统运行过程中,根据用户反馈和业务发展需求,对系统进行持续优化,包括功能优化、性能优化、安全性优化等。
三、PDM产品生产系统二次开发注意事项
- 确保系统稳定性
在二次开发过程中,要确保系统稳定性,避免因开发导致系统崩溃或数据丢失。
- 考虑兼容性
在开发过程中,要考虑新功能模块与原有功能模块的兼容性,确保系统整体运行顺畅。
- 重视用户培训
在系统部署与实施过程中,要重视用户培训,确保用户能够熟练使用系统。
- 持续优化
在系统运行过程中,要持续关注用户反馈和业务发展需求,对系统进行持续优化。
总之,PDM产品生产系统的二次开发需要充分考虑企业需求、系统设计、开发与测试、部署与实施、持续优化等方面。通过合理规划、精心实施,可以有效提升PDM系统的性能和功能,为企业创造更大的价值。
猜你喜欢:工业CAD